John Bridgeman Limited, in the matter of John Bridgeman Limited v National Stock Exchange of Australia Limited (No 2) [2021] FCA 319 File number: QUD 659 of 2019
Judgment of: JACKSON J
Date of judgment: 31 March 2021
Catchwords: PRACTICE AND PROCEDURE - interlocutory application for leave to rely on affidavits filed after due date - interlocutory application for leave to file further amended statement of claim - overarching purpose of civil practice and procedure provisions - applications granted but indemnity costs ordered against applicant
Legislation: Federal Court of Australia Act 1976 (Cth) s 37M
Cases cited: Aon Risk Services Australia Limited v Australian National University [2009] HCA 27; (2009) 239 CLR 175 Black & Decker (Australasia) Pty Ltd v GMCA Pty Ltd [2007] FCA 1623 John Bridgeman Limited v National Stock Exchange of Australia Limited [2019] FCA 1127 John Bridgeman Limited, in the matter of John Bridgeman Limited v National Stock Exchange of Australia Limited [2020] FCA 941
